Qt
Victor_zero
这个作者很懒,什么都没留下…
展开
-
pyqt5在win10下用pyinstaller打包成exe,打包后的界面风格变成了win98解决办法
例如:直接调试界面:用pyinstaller打包后的界面:pyinstaller -F -w Ui_hello.py问题在于少了样式文件。如果不用-F的话,可以去 Python 目录下找 Lib\site-packages\PyQt5\Qt\plugins\styles, 把整个目录拷贝到生成目录的对应位置。如果要用-F的话,那么最好创建spec文件,然后添加要复制的文件,比如:a = Analy...原创 2018-07-08 08:34:38 · 2747 阅读 · 0 评论 -
自定义QScrollArea类,使其鼠标可拖拽图片移动
class myWidgetScrollArea(QScrollArea): def __init__(self, father): super().__init__() self.fatherWidet = father self.last_time_move_x = 0 self.last_time_move_y = 0 self.scrollBarX = self...原创 2018-07-18 08:01:24 · 1080 阅读 · 0 评论 -
PyQt5 将窗口暂时置于所有窗口最前方(唤醒窗口、窗口置顶)
void QWidget::raise()Raises this widget to the top of the parent widget's stack.After this call the widget will be visually in front of any overlapping sibling widgets.Note: When using activateW...原创 2018-07-29 10:20:50 · 12797 阅读 · 3 评论 -
Windows XP下 安装PyQt5并使用Pyinstaller打包程序
windows XP 下不可以使用较高版本的PyQt5模块工作和打包,所以需要对其安装指定版本的库及依赖包:配置环境(名称:版本号):Windows XP 32 位Python 3.4.4PyQt5 5.5.1(PyQt5-5.5.1-gpl-Py3.4-Qt5.5.1-x32)PyWin32 pywin32-219.win32-py3.4Pyinstaller 3.2.1...原创 2018-10-03 20:07:57 · 2132 阅读 · 2 评论 -
Qt 中控件按照比例大小进行缩放
使用函数QBoxLayout.setStretch(int index, int stretch)进行设置,第一个参数是布局内控件的index,第二个参数是需要缩放的比例,如果多个控件需要成比例缩放,则使用多次按编号调用此函数,并传入对应比例参数。...原创 2018-10-24 18:33:01 · 4428 阅读 · 0 评论